t0020: fix ignored exit code inside loops
A loop like:
for f in one two; do
something $f ||
break
done
will correctly break out of the loop when we see a failure
of one item, but the resulting exit code will always be
zero. We can fix that by putting the loop into a function or
subshell, but in this case it is simpler still to just
unroll the loop. We do add a helper function, which
hopefully makes the end result even more readable (in
addition to being shorter).
